From 9193e54e87c971f4dc1df1dfd49038ce2f0a2e0b Mon Sep 17 00:00:00 2001 From: Philip Peterson <1326208+philip-peterson@users.noreply.github.com> Date: Fri, 5 Jun 2026 00:30:25 -0700 Subject: [PATCH] wip --- docker/php/entrypoint.sh |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/docker/php/entrypoint.sh b/docker/php/entrypoint.sh index 8f53d9d..72b26bc 100644 --- a/docker/php/entrypoint.sh +++ b/docker/php/entrypoint.sh @@ -66,15 +66,15 @@ if [ -n "${POSTMARK_API_KEY:-}" ]; then \$storage->create([ 'id' => 'postmark', 'label' => 'Postmark', - 'plugin' => 'smtp', + 'plugin' => 'dsn', 'configuration' => ['dsn' => 'postmark+api://' . getenv('POSTMARK_API_KEY') . '@default'], ])->save(); } - \$config = \Drupal::configFactory()->getEditable('mailer_transport.settings'); - \$config->set('default_transport', 'postmark')->save(); + \Drupal::configFactory()->getEditable('mailer_transport.settings') + ->set('default_transport', 'postmark')->save(); \Drupal::configFactory()->getEditable('system.mail') ->set('interface.default', 'symfony_mailer')->save(); - " && echo "[entrypoint] Postmark transport configured." || echo "[entrypoint] WARNING: Postmark transport setup failed." + " && echo "[entrypoint] Postmark transport configured." || { echo "[entrypoint] FATAL: Postmark transport setup failed."; exit 1; } fi $DRUSH en -y riverside_pt && \ echo "[entrypoint] riverside_pt enabled." || echo "[entrypoint] WARNING: riverside_pt failed."